What is 12-bit color depth?

A display system that provides 4,096 shades of color for each red, green and blue subpixel for a total of 68 billion colors. For example, Dolby Vision supports 12-bit color. A 36-bit color depth also means 12-bit color because the 36 refers to each pixel, not the subpixel.

What is color depth 36 bits per pixel 12-bit?

36-bit. Using 12 bits per color channel produces 36 bits, 68,719,476,736 colors. If an alpha channel of the same size is added then there are 48 bits per pixel.

What's better 8-bit or 12-bit?

8-bit colour distinguishes 256 different tones, 10-bit colour distinguishes 1024 tones, and 12-bit colour distinguishes 4096 tones. For example, let's take a look at the sunset images below. The image recorded with the higher bit depth has a smoother gradient and more highlight details.

Is JPEG 8-bit or 12-bit?

JPEG is an '8-bit' format in that each color channel uses 8-bits of data to describe the tonal value of each pixel. This means that the three color channels used to make up the photo (red, green and blue) all use 8-bits of data – so sometimes these are also called 24-bit images (3 x 8-bit).

How many bits per pixel for HDR?

32-bit images (i.e. 96 bits per pixel for a color image) are considered High Dynamic Range. Unlike 8- and 16-bit images which can take a finite number of values, 32-bit images are coded using floating point numbers, which means the values they can take is unlimited.
